HYHG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

37 of the 6,222 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ProShares High Yield-Interest Rate Hedged ETF (HYHG)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$51.5M — down 1.1% from $52.1M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 6 funds closed out of HYHG and 5 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 15 trimmed existing stakes and 11 added.

The largest buyer was Sound Income Strategies, opening a new position worth an estimated $3.81M. The largest seller was Wells Fargo, cutting an estimated $3.7M.
